Not really comparable as in said places there is only one station
served by exernal trains so the internal transport system must absorb
all onwards movements to the other terminals. In Heathrow, the
external transport system can take you directly to the terminal of
your choice. This is a better service as passengers don't like to
change trains, especially not with luggage.

The most ridiculous system I've come across so far is in Dallas (DFW).
The TRE train stops at a station called "DFW airport" but isn't
anywhere near the airport. From there, there's a connecting shuttle
bus. But the shuttle bus doesn't go to the airport either but drops
you off at one of the peripheral parking lots from where the car park
shuttle bus takes you to the air terminal. I don't know whether
they're worried about the rail shuttle bus contaimating the airport or
something. Despite teh hassle there are still quite a few people using
it.
